Nico Echavarria beats Tiger Woods’ record, books trip to Augusta National with ZOZO win

Nico Echavarria claimed his second career PGA Tour title in Japan and beat Tiger Woods’ scoring record in the process.

Colombian Nico Echavarria shot a 3-under 67 to best Justin Thomas and Max Greyserman by a stroke at the ZOZO Championship in Japan on Sunday.

He finished at 20-under-par and capped off a stellar week in the Far East with two birdies over his last three holes. He also set a new ZOZO Championship scoring record with an overall score of 260, besting the record Tiger Woods set with his victory in Japan in 2019—his most recent PGA Tour title.

“It’s incredible to win a tournament that Tiger’s won,” Echavarria said.

“This is my second victory, so I just need 80 more victories to catch him. I’m on my way, though.”

Echavarria’s win is a career-changing moment. His only other PGA Tour title came at the 2023 Puerto Rico, an alternate event that does not award perks like this week’s ZOZO Championship. With the win, Echavarria books a trip to Augusta National next April and the PGA Championship at Quail Hollow next May. He will also begin his season at The Sentry in Maui and tee it up at TPC Sawgrass for The Players in March. In addition, Echavarria secures status on the PGA Tour for two more years.

But nothing excites him more than going to The Masters for the first time.

“I’m very excited to go to Augusta for the first time. I’ve never been,” Echavarria said.

“I was waiting to win myself that trip before going, and we’ve done that, so we’re going to be very happy to play the Masters in a couple of months.”
